Q-dependence of zero degree binary encounter electron production for Si{sup q+}, and Cu{sup 1+} on H{sub 2}

The elastic scattering model, ESM, predicts the binary encounter electron spectra extremely well for low Z projectiles (Z<10). The ESM is compared here to the experimental double differential cross sections for 1 MeV/u Si (q=4 to 13) and Cl (q=5 to 13) on H{sub 2} and 0.5 MeV/u Cu (q=4,5, 11 to 15) on H{sub 2}. The magnitude and the shape of the ESM agree fairly well with experiment, however, the ESM peak positions occur systematically at a higher energy than the experiment.
